Biography
ANDRA is quickly establishing herself as a vital and singular musical force. The emotional depth and of her song-writing combined with her fluid, soulful singing emphasizes her eloquent lyrics, expressive voice and openhearted sense of simplicity and directness. She has an immense voice. Think Eddie Vedder having coffee with Alanis Morisette as Jeff Buckley interrupts to introduce the young Marianne Faithful.

Born in Namibia and raised in Swakopmund – a desert down on the west coast of Africa, ANDRA has been exposed to music since childhood, and at the tender age of nine was inspired by Bruce Springsteen to pick up a tennis racket and start playing air guitar. Luckily, her dad passed on his guitar, and after six years of classical training she decided to focus on her own style – or, as she calls it: “stories and sounds”.

In 2007 she took her life savings, packed her guitar and percolator and moved to South Africa. Once in Pretoria, she met up with producer Ludwig Bouwer. Four Months later, ANDRA’s debut album, the acclaimed “Secrets and Skeletons... Notes from a Desert Cafe” was released, an album drawing immense attention from around the country and the world. The album consists of 12 tracks, all written and composed by ANDRA.

What’s even better, the 23-year old steps up to the plate when performing live. Her performances are intense and the lyrics, prolific. Her husky voice and formidable guitar playing on stage has won ANDRA critical acclaim from her peers and a steadily expanding audience. Audiences at the 2008 Aardklop, Hartsfees and Strab Festivals will vouch for that. In addition, she is also confirmed to perform at every major South African music festival in 2009, including Up The Creek, The Klein Karoo Nasionale Kunstefees, Splashy Fen, Oppikoppi, Strab, InniBos, the White Mountain Folk Festival and Aardklop.
